Government headhunter PESB on Wednesday did not find any of the 12 shortlisted candidates, including serving directors, suitable for the post of NTPC chairman and suggested the government to find incumbent Gurdeep Singh’s successor through the search-cum-selection committee route.
This is the latest in a series of instances since 2021 years when the PESB has rejected the panel of candidates interviewed for the top job in ONGC, IOC, HPCL and BPCL. Singh, who himself was selected through this route in 2016, will superannuate on July 31.
